#d32228 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d32228 is composed of 82.7% red, 13.3% green and 15.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 83.9% magenta, 81% yellow and 17.3% black. It has a hue angle of 358 degrees, a saturation of 72.2% and a lightness of 48%. #d32228 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ff4450 with #a70000. Closest websafe color is: #cc3333.

Shades and Tints of #d32228
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#080102 is the darkest color, while #fef6f7 is the lightest one.

Tones of #d32228
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7e7777 is the less saturated color, while #ef060e is the most saturated one.
